Village
Docking is an attractive central village only 3-4 miles inland from the North Norfolk Coast, making a great base to stay and explore the whole of North Norfolk. It's a traditional farming Norfolk village which boasts a village shop with post office, traditional pub and a fish and chip shop too! Its located close to Burnham Market within easy access of the coast with Brancaster to the north and Hunstanton to the west. The village also has a lovely church St Mary’s, village school and a ‘must visit’ farmers market which takes place on a Wednesday morning in the ‘Ripper Hall’ village hall
History
The village has an elevated position, in the past was nick named ‘Dry Docking’ as it had no water supply other than rainwater. In the 1760’s a single well was dug for the village providing domestic use for a farthing a bucket. The water was also transported around the village by horse and cart selling the water by the bucket.
Visit
There is such ease of access to all villages and attractions with Houghton Hall to the south and Royal Sandringham Estate and House also nearby. The superb coastline with RSBP reserves and all of the areas of outstanding natural beauty are nearby to explore. There also are lots of routes from the village for cyclists and walkers.

Electric Vehicle charging
Cars may only be charged if there is an EV charging point fitted at the property. The cost of electricity is NOT included in the rental price and Sowerbys Holiday Cottages must be notified if the charger is used and an additional surcharge will be made. Due to insurance purposes, guests must never charge their car using a standard outdoor plug or an extension cable linking to a domestic plug. This is not permitted because of fire regulations regarding wiring, earthing rods and voltage restrictions; it poses a serious fire risk to standard 13 amp sockets and there is a real danger that the body of the vehicle could become live.
